DELHI chief minister's dharna attracted widespread attention. Some have termed this dharna as an example of 'mobocracy' and said lawmakers should not come out protesting on the streets. A petition was filed in the Supreme Court against the dharna, stating that the chief minister had violated the constitution, on which he had taken an oath. For the AAP, chief minister sitting on a dharna is its way of combining 'politics with activism' and one of the means to strengthen democracy.
SCIENTISTS and engineers at ISRO, and people all over India, heaved a huge sigh of relief and cheered loudly, at the successful launch on January 5 of the GSLV D5 rocket with an indigenous cryogenic engine and the accurate insertion of the 2 tonne GSAT-14 satellite into geo-synchronous orbit. The notes of triumph and release from tension were palpable at Sriharikota, and the ISRO team would be forgiven for any hyperbole that might have crept into their self-congratulatory speeches.
IN the late nineteen sixties and the early nineteen seventies, an argument used to be put forward by theorists of Social Democracy that went as follows. In any society, wealth inequality is always greater than income inequality; but if this income inequality is curtailed, then that ipso facto has the effect of curtailing wealth inequality as well, and that too quite substantially.

THE Struggle Committee for Minority Rights (Alpasankhyank Hakka Sangharsh Samiti) held its first Maharashtra state convention at Solapur on January 8, 2014; it was attended by 625 delegates from 10 districts. The convention was presided over by Narsayya Adam, Rehana Shaikh and Mohammed Tajuddin. The reception committee chairman, Yusuf Shaikh (Major), welcomed the delegates.

A PROTEST meeting was organised by the Democratic Youth Federation of India’s Maharashtra state committee condemning the FIR filed against Teesta Setalwad in an Ahmedabad police station. DYFI all India president M B Rajesh, MP addressed the protest gathering held on January 10 at Dadar. Speaking on the occasion, he said that the FIR is the most vindictive act by the Modi government designed as a form of punishment for her fight for justice on behalf of Zakia Jafri and other victim families of the Gujarat violence of 2002.
ON January 15, CPI(M) activists staged a huge protest demonstration at Kulgam in South Kashmir against the irregular power supply, dismal functioning of the public distribution system (PDS), scarcity of essential commodities and safe drinking water.
The protesting activists marched from the Bus Stand to the Mini Secretariat, carrying placards and banners, shouting slogans. The procession culminated in a demonstration and rally at the Mini Secretariat, which was addressed by various party leaders.
